Richmond & Twickenham Chess Club will be holding their first meeting at their new venue, The Adelaide, Park Road, Teddington, on Tuesday 4 January, from 7:30 to 10:30.

The Adelaide was the venue of Thames Valley Chess Club (formerly Twickenham Chess Club, but later amalgamated with Kingston Chess Club) for several years from 1901.

We look forward to welcoming our members and opponents in the Thames Valley and Surrey Leagues shortly.

This is unlikely to be sustainable given the history of chess clubs in South West London. Richmond and Kingston are transport hubs which act as mainstems into which the tributaries of the temporary local clubs flow. Depending upon how you read the history over the last 150 years or so, Kingston has absorbed Twickenham and Teddington via a period as Thames Valley. Richmond has absorbed a later manifestation of Twickenham CC. Meanwhile, Wimbledon, Surbiton, Epsom and Battersea have retained name continuity even if the clubs occasionally went into abeyance.

The diagram is part of the Kingston CC sequicentennial history project.

It's in the London Borough of Richmond upon Thames. On that basis it has at least as much right its name as Chelsea Football Club has given that it's in Hammersmith and Fulham rather than Kensington and Chelsea.
